📝 About this app

Never lose your car again with Find My Car – the simple and effective parking locator app. Whether you’re at a mall, stadium, or city street, Find My Car helps you quickly save your parking spot and navigate back to it with ease.

🧭 Save Your Spot Instantly
Mark your parking location with a single tap. Your spot is saved with GPS coordinates and map view for fast retrieval.

🗺️ Navigate Back with Ease
Use built-in GPS to get directions back to your vehicle.… View full description on the official store →
